- Counting money and calculating profits from selling crops
- Measuring time and planning daily tasks based on time constraints
- Understanding percentages when buying and selling items
- Estimating distances when planting crops and placing buildings
- Calculating the number of crops needed to complete bundles in the community center
One creative way to continue developing math skills through playing Stardew Valley is to have the child keep track of their expenses and profits in a spreadsheet. They can also practice budgeting by setting goals for how much money they want to make in a certain amount of time and figuring out how much they need to sell each day to reach that goal. Additionally, they can practice graphing by creating charts to track their progress over time.
